The Bachelor of Arts in Theatre degree is a flexible program, offering the traditional degree or coupling concentrations in either Design & Entertainment Technology or Musical Theatre. No matter the path you choose, you will begin to hone your craft in your first semester. Through your journey, you will dig deeply into your theatre studies, balancing them with a broad general education component while emphasizing collaboration, time management, self-motivation, and empathy. Graduating with our Bachelor of Arts In Theatre degree prepares you for entry-level professional positions, graduate study, or a path of your own design.

Student Learning Outcomes


Theater, BA Program Level Outcomes

  • Ability to think conceptually and critically about text, performance, and production 
  • Understanding of process from playwrighting through production 
  • Describe a wide selection of theatre repertory including the principal eras, genres, and cultural sources 
  • Understanding of procedures and approaches for realizing a wide variety of theatrical styles 
  • Ability to develop and defend informed judgments about theatre

Theater, No Concentration Outcomes

  • Ability and proficiency in technical skills required in areas of performance, production, playwrighting or other specific areas of interest
  • Intermediate to advanced competence in one or more theatre specializations in creation, performance, scholarship or teaching
  • Presentation skills including resume and audition package/portfolio

Design & Entertainment Technology Concentration Outcomes

  • Ability and proficiency in technical skills required in areas of design and entertainment technology
  • Competence in one or more specializations in design and entertainment technology
  • Presentation skills including resume portfolio
